Output 68805124641374cef442ecafc94cb51a5e4ad977e687f2cad206808a4cf3067a:13

value
668423629
script pubkey
OP_HASH160 OP_PUSHBYTES_20 acfec52f907d582c378e5e20fe1eddae75c94fdc OP_EQUAL
address
3HTjMHZdAew1bsqkj6LeUR4RWsCt9VpMoj
transaction
68805124641374cef442ecafc94cb51a5e4ad977e687f2cad206808a4cf3067a
spent
true